Cafe Yarmarka
1530 Post Alley
Seattle, WA 98101
206-521-9054
Stop by this market stall during a slow moment and you'll spot the women who run it nimbly folding trays' worth of pelmeni (tiny meat-stuffed dumplings). The baked piroshki get rewarmed in the microwave, so pass them over in favor of dumplings or stuffed cabbages like that woman in your grandma's building used to make, with sides of beet and sauerkraut salads. Would ordering a Russian tea cookie for dessert be taking the Slavic thing too far? No, it would not.
